Going Wireless: one of the biggest assets of industrial wireless systems is how they greatly diminish the use of wires in the workplace. In factories, wires can be a serious hazard, especially if they are not placed correctly; they could lead to accidents. But with this technology, that will no longer be a problem. This technology uses electrical waves to communicate between machines in real time, meaning you don’t need to worry about lags in production. This could lead to better communication between you and your equipment, allowing for a steady flow of production.
